What is the difference between Weekend Network Engineer vs Part-Time Network Technician?
Career: Weekend Network Engineer
| Aspect | Weekend Network Engineer | Part-Time Network Technician |
|---|---|---|
| Certifications | CCNA, CompTIA Network+ | CCNA, CompTIA Network+ |
| Work Environment | Data centers, corporate offices, on-site support | Retail stores, small offices, remote sites |
| Employer & Industry | IT service providers, large corporations | Small businesses, retail chains |
| Work Schedule | Weekend shifts, part-time hours | Flexible, part-time shifts, often weekends |
Both roles involve network troubleshooting, maintenance, and support, often requiring similar certifications. The main difference lies in the work environment and schedule, with Weekend Network Engineers typically working in larger organizations during weekends, while Part-Time Network Technicians may work in smaller settings with flexible hours, including weekends.
